The Characteristic Linked To A Briefer Lifestyle

.They perished approximately two years earlier.They passed away around 2 years earlier.People who are extremely downhearted concerning the future are at a higher risk of passing away earlier, a research finds.Pessimists, the study located, perished approximately pair of years earlier than their less cynical peers.Highly cynical individuals, though, compose less than 10 percent of the population.Dr John Whitfield, the study's 1st writer, said:" Our company found individuals that were actually definitely pessimistic concerning the future were actually most likely to perish previously from heart attacks and other causes, but certainly not from cancer.Optimism ratings on the other hand carried out disappoint a considerable relationship along with death, either good or even negative.Less than nine per-cent of respondents identified as being definitely pessimistic.There were actually no significant variations in positive outlook or even cynicism between guys as well as women.On standard, a person's level of either positive outlook or even pessimism improved along with age.We also found anxiety did certainly not seem to represent the affiliation in between grief and also death." The research study consisted of almost 3,000 individuals that accomplished tests of optimism and also pessimism.Dr Whitfield believes that positive outlook as well as grief are actually certainly not direct opposites:" The crucial component of our outcomes is actually that our company made use of 2 separate scales to measure pessimism and also positive outlook and also their organization with all reasons for death.That is actually just how our experts found that while strong gloomy outlook was actually related to earlier fatality, those that racked up strongly on the confidence range carried out not possess a more than common lifestyle expectancy.We assume it's not likely that the illness caused the pessimism due to the fact that our company carried out not find that folks that died coming from cancer cells had signed up a strong pessimism rating in their tests.If illness was actually triggering greater pessimism scores, it should possess put on cancers cells along with to heart disease." It may be beneficial to the health of the strongly pessimistic to find out to transform their character, stated Dr Whitfield:" Recognizing that our long term health and wellness may be affected by whether we are actually a cup-half-full or even cup-half-empty type of person might be the timely our experts need to attempt to transform the means we encounter the world, and try to reduce negativity, also in actually difficult circumstances."
